their expiry date. health officials say, the jabs were delivered by international donors, just before their expiry date, which did not give them enough time to distribute them around the country. nigeria is facing a fourth wave of the pandemic with the centre for disease control saying, that there's been 500% increase in infections rates in the last two weeks let's turn away from coronavirus developments and bring you another important story. it's nearly a week, since a super typhoon hit the philippines — killing at least 375 people, and leaving hundreds of thousands without shelter. one of the worst affected areas was the popular tourist island of shargo. from there, our correspondent howard johnson sent this report. devastation as far as the eye can see. voted best island in asia this year by conde nast, devastation as far as the eye can see. siargao now resembles an apocalyptic mess. super typhoon rai first made landfall here last thursday, packing winds in excess of 150 miles
